Netvigator VPS上如何部署和管理数据库服务?

Netvigator VPS上部署和管理数据库服务指南

随着云计算技术的普及,VPS(虚拟专用服务器)已经成为许多企业和个人开发者构建应用程序、网站等项目的首选。在这些项目中,数据库服务是不可或缺的一部分。本篇文章将详细介绍如何在Netvigator VPS上部署和管理数据库服务。

Netvigator VPS上如何部署和管理数据库服务?

一、选择合适的数据库

根据您的具体需求来选择适合自己的关系型或非关系型数据库产品非常重要。例如,如果您正在开发一个需要处理大量结构化数据的传统Web应用,那么MySQL或者PostgreSQL可能是一个不错的选择;而如果您的应用场景涉及到大量的半结构化或者非结构化数据,并且对查询速度有较高要求的话,MongoDB这样的NoSQL数据库可能会更加合适。

二、安装数据库

确定好要使用的数据库类型之后,就可以开始进行安装了。以Linux系统为例,通常可以通过包管理器如yum/apt-get来进行快速安装:

对于CentOS/RHEL:

yum install mysql-server -y MySQL

yum install postgresql-server -y PostgreSQL

对于Debian/Ubuntu:

apt-get update && apt-get install mysql-server -y MySQL

apt-get update && apt-get install postgresql -y PostgreSQL

请注意,在某些情况下,您可能还需要额外安装一些依赖库或者其他相关组件才能使数据库正常工作。

三、初始化配置与安全设置

完成安装后,应该立即执行必要的初始化操作并调整默认的安全设置。这包括但不限于:为root用户创建强密码、禁用不必要的远程访问权限、更改默认端口等等。请确保定期备份重要数据,并启用防火墙规则仅允许来自可信IP地址的连接请求。

四、日常维护与性能优化

为了保证数据库系统的稳定性和高效性,必须做好以下几方面的工作:

  • 监控资源使用情况(CPU、内存、磁盘IO等),及时发现潜在问题;
  • 根据实际情况调整参数配置文件中的关键项(如缓冲池大小、最大连接数等),以提高性能表现;
  • 定期清理不再使用的表空间、索引以及过期的日志记录,减少存储开销;
  • 采用合适的分片策略将大数据集拆分成多个较小的部分,从而加快读写速度。

五、故障排查与恢复

即使采取了所有预防措施,偶尔也会遇到意外情况导致数据库无法正常工作。此时不要慌张,按照以下步骤逐步解决问题:

  1. 查看错误日志文件,定位到具体的报错信息;
  2. 查阅官方文档或者社区论坛寻找解决方案;
  3. 尝试重启服务进程,有时候简单的重启就能解决问题;
  4. 如果上述方法均无效,则考虑从最近的一次完整备份中恢复数据。

通过以上五个方面的介绍,相信您已经掌握了如何在Netvigator VPS上成功部署和有效管理数据库服务的基本技能。实际操作过程中还会遇到各种各样的具体情况,这就需要大家不断积累经验并保持学习的态度了。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/106203.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 3天前
下一篇 3天前

相关推荐

  • VPS上Ping命令返回异常时应如何排查问题?

    VPS(虚拟专用服务器)是一种灵活且强大的托管解决方案,允许用户在共享硬件上运行自己的操作系统和应用程序。当我们在VPS上使用Ping命令返回异常时,这可能是网络连接不稳定或服务器故障的迹象。为了确保系统的稳定性和高效性,我们需要及时进行问题排查。 二、检查Ping命令是否正确 我们应确认命令是否正确,确保输入的IP地址或域名无误。如果ping的是一个特定的…

    2天前
    400
  • VPS数据备份策略:为什么重要以及如何实现自动化备份?

    VPS(虚拟专用服务器)已经成为许多企业和个人用户托管其网站、应用程序和在线服务的首选。随着对VPS依赖性的增加,确保数据的安全性和可恢复性变得至关重要。这就是为什么制定并实施有效的VPS数据备份策略如此重要的原因。 意外的数据丢失可能由多种因素引起,如硬件故障、软件错误、网络攻击或人为失误。没有适当的数据备份措施,这些事件可能导致关键业务信息的永久丢失,从…

    1天前
    300
  • 为什么我的VPS解析IP后无法正常访问网站?

    VPS(虚拟专用服务器)是一种非常受欢迎的托管解决方案,它为用户提供了一个独立的操作环境。在设置和使用过程中,用户可能会遇到一些问题,例如在将域名指向VPS IP地址后无法正常访问网站。这可能是由多种原因造成的。 DNS配置错误 如果DNS记录配置不正确,那么即使你的VPS已经正确设置了web服务,也无法通过域名来访问它。确保你已经在域名注册商那里添加了A记…

    13小时前
    100
  • WDCP VPS多站点部署:如何在同一服务器上托管多个网站?

    WDCP VPS多站点部署:如何在同一服务器上托管多个网站 随着互联网的发展,许多企业和个人需要在同一台服务器上托管多个网站。这不仅可以节省成本,还能提高资源利用率。本文将介绍如何使用WDCP(Web Data Center Panel)在VPS(虚拟私有服务器)上实现多站点部署。 什么是WDCP? WDCP 是一款基于Linux的服务器管理面板,专为中小型…

    21小时前
    100
  • 云服务器与VPS有何区别?如何选择适合自己的主机服务

    云服务器和虚拟专用服务器(VPS)是两种常见的网络托管服务,但它们之间存在一些关键差异。了解这些差异有助于您选择适合自己的主机服务。 VPS是物理服务器的虚拟化版本,每个VPS都有独立的操作系统、资源和配置。它共享同一台物理服务器上的硬件资源,这可能会导致性能波动或受到其他用户的影响。相比之下,云服务器是一种基于云计算技术构建的虚拟化服务器,可以提供更灵活的…

    10小时前
    200

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部